Cargo Warehouse Handling Essentials

The course provides participants with theoretical knowledge of authority stakeholders in the cargo process, as well as all necessary existing IATA regulations mandatory for the handling of cargo. It explains the basic principles and processes of handling inbound and outbound cargo. The participants will know the most important functions in the cargo business, likewise the needed technical equipment and they will have an idea about a good structured warehouse and other necessary facilities. Topics like the secure supply chain and special handling will be explained in detail. The training is rounded off by a tour of the airport’s subsidiary warehouse and the apron to observe an aircraft loading.

Content

  • What is cargo handling, who are the stakeholders and why is security so important?
- Federal aviation authorities
- Cargo Security – Regulated agents / ACC
- Customs
  • People and functions in cargo according to European regulations
  • Facilities and equipment according to cargo structure (small packages vs. big and heavy cargo)
  • IATA regulations for cargo handling
- ICHM, ULD Regulations, AHM, IGOM
- DGR, LBSG, LAR, PCR, TCR
- Certificates and backgrounds
  • Tour of airport’s subsidiary warehouse (Cargogate Munich Airport GmbH)
